1    login帐户登录
login:下,输入用户名,密码,进入显示shell名令提示符,超级用户  #>,普通用户B Shell  $>C Shell  %>
2    su更换帐户
[语法]: su [- ] [用户名]
[说明]: su 命令使当前用户成为指定用户,若无指定,则成为超级用户,但必须输入该用户的密码,-选项表示用该用户的注册环境成为该用户
3    exit退出帐户
exit 
logout  ctrld(强制退出)
4    haltsys命令关机
haltsys命令一发出,就会立即把系统关闭掉。其优点是系统响应快,强迫性强,因此,该命令只适合于系统上只有一个用户的情况。如果系统上有多个用户在工作,一发出命令,这些用户就被迫退出系统,他们的进程也丢失了。操作方法是:以超级用户登录,输入haltsys,回车,系统显示关机信息时,关掉电源。
5    reboot命令关机
reboot命令是由系统管理员执行的停机程序,reboot实质上是和haltsys命令链接在一起的。reboothaltsys的唯一区别是它在正常停机后不用按任意键,马上自动引导,重新启动系统。reboot特别适合系统管理员调试机器用。
6    shutdown命令关机
shutdown命令是一个用shell语言编写的程序,驻留在/etc目录中。它由超级用户在前台运行,自动执行wall命令,通知正在系统中工作的所有用户,系统将在指定的时间内停机,请做好准备工作,然后从系统中注销。当所有用户已从系统中注销或指定时间已到时,shutdo
wn就执行kill命令把系统中除主控台外的所有进程都终止,接着执行haltsys命令使系统正常停机。使用格式:shutdown g[hh:]mm f"Mesg",其中[hh:]mm是系统指定关机时间,“Mesg"是系统向各终端用户发送的信息。在网络用户中推荐使用shutdown命令来关机。
[语法]: shutdown [-y] [-gn] [-in]
[说明]: UNIX 系统必须先关闭系统,再关电源
-y 对提示的所有问题都回答 y
-gn 给其他用户n 秒的时间退出,缺省值为60
-in 系统退到第n种方式,方式如下:
0 关机
1 单用户模式
2 多用户模式
3 网络下的多用户模式
6 关机并重新启动
7    init
系统启动时,init进程是第一个被产生的进程。init是所有进程的祖先﹐它的进程号始终为1﹐所以发送TERM信号给init会终止所有的用户进程﹑守护进程等。shutdown 就是使用这种机制。init定义了8个运行级别(runlevel)
命令格式:init  n
0 关机
1 单用户模式
2 多用户模式
3 网络下的多用户模式
6 关机并重新启动
8    man 查命令的解释
man 是手册 ( manual ) 的意思。 UNIX 提供线上辅助( on-line help )的功能,man 就是用来让使用者在使用时查询指令、系统呼叫、标准程式库函式、各种表格等的使用所用的。man 的用法如下:
man [-M path] [[section] title ] .....
man [-M path] -k keyword ...
-M path man 所需要的 manual database 的路径。
我们也可以用设定环境变数 MANPATH 的方式来取代 -M 选项。
title 这是所要查询的目的物。
section 为一个数字表示 manual 的分类,通常 1 代表可执行指令,
9    cd 目录转换,等同于doscd命令
注意目录分隔符为“/”,与dos相反
命令格式:cd dirname
10    pwd
[语法]: pwd
[说明] 本命令用于显示当前的工作目录
[例子]:
pwd 显示出当前的工作目录
11    who
[语法]: who
who am i
[说明]: 列出现在系统中的用户,who am i 怎么把隐藏的文件显示出来显示自己
12    passwd
[语法]: passwd [用户]
[说明]: 修改密码,指定用户则修改指定用户密码
13    date
[语法]: date
date mmddhhmm[yy]
[说明]: date 无参数时用于显示系统时间,修改时间时参数形式为
月日时分[]
14    ls 显示文件名,等同于dosdir命令
命令格式:ls [option] file
option
-l 显示详细列表
文件类型和权限 | 文件连接数 |所有者| 用户组脉| 文件长度 | 修改日期 | 文件名
-a 显示所有文件,包含隐藏文件(以. 起头的文件名)
-R 显示文件及所有子目录
-F 显示文件(后跟*)和目录(后跟/
-d l选项合用,显示目录名而非其内容
-p
15    more以分页方式查看一个长文本文件内容.
命令格式:more filename
16    mkdir 创建目录
命令格式: mkdir [-p] directory-name
Exmaple
mkdir dir1 (建立一新目录 dir1.))
mkdir -p dir/subdir (直接创建多级目录)
17    rmdir 删除目录
目录必须首先为空
命令格式: rmdir directory
18    cp 文档复制 | cp –r 目录复制
命令格式: cp [-r] source destination
Exmaple:
cp -i file1 file2           (将文档 file1 复制成 file2 . –i为提示确认。)
cp file1 dir1              将文档 file1 复制到目录 dir1 下,文件名仍为 file1.
cp /tmp/file1 .            将目录 /tmp 下的文档 file1复制到现行目录下,档名仍为 file1.
cp /tmp/file1 file2      将目录 /tmp 下的文档 file1现行目录下,档名为file2
cp -r dir1 dir2            (recursive copy) 复制整个目录.若目录 dir2 不存在,则将目录dir1,及其所有文档和子目录,复制到目录 dir2 下,新目录名称为dir1.若目录dir2不存在,则将dir1,及其所有文档和子目录,复制为目录 dir2.
19    mv 文件移动 | 重命名
命令格式: mv source destination
Exmaple:
mv file1 file2 file1重命名为 file2.
mv file1 dir1 将文档 file1,移到目录 dir1 下,档名仍为 file1.
mv dir1 dir2 若目录 dir2 不存在,则将目录 dir1,及其所有档
案和子目录,移到目录 dir2 下,新目录名称为 dir1.
若目录 dir2 不存在,则将dir1,及其所有文档和子
目录,更改为目录 dir2.
20    rm 删除文件
命令格式: rm [-r] filename (filename 可为档名,或档名缩写符号.)
例子
rm file1 删除档名为 file1 之文档.
rm file? 删除档名中有五个字元,前四个字元为file 之所有文档.
rm f* 删除档名中,以 f 为字首之所有文档.
rm -r dir1 删除目录 dir1,及其下所有文档及子目录.
21    chmod
[语法]: chmod [-R] 模式 文件...
chmod [ugoa] {+|-|=} [rwxst] 文件...
[说明]: 改变文件的存取模式,存取模式可表示为数字或符号串,例如:
chmod nnnn file n0-7的数字,意义如下:
4000 运行时可改变UID
2000 运行时可改变GID
1000 置粘着位
0400 文件主可读
0200 文件主可写
0100 文件主可执行
0040 同组用户可读
0020 同组用户可写
0010 同组用户可执行
0004 其他用户可读
0002 其他用户可写
0001 其他用户可执行
nnnn 就是上列数字相加得到的,例如 chmod 0777 file 是指将文件 file 存取权限置为所有用户可读可写可执行。
-R 递归地改变所有子目录下所有文件的存取模式
u 文件主
g 同组用户
o 其他用户
a 所有用户
+ 增加后列权限
- 取消后列权限
= 置成后列权限
r 可读
w 可写
x 可执行
s 运行时可置UID
t 运行时可置GID
[例子]:
chmod 0666 file1 file2 将文件 file1 file2 置为所有用户可读可写
chmod u+x file 对文件 file 增加文件主可执行权限
chmod o-rwx 对文件file 取消其他用户的所有权限
22    chown
[语法]: chown [-R] 文件主 文件...
[说明]: 文件的UID表示文件的文件主,文件主可用数字表示, 也可用一个有效的用户名表示,此命令改变一个文件的UID,仅当此文件的文件主或超级用户可使用。
-R 递归地改变所有子目录下所有文件的存取模式
[例子]:
chown mary file 将文件 file 的文件主改为 mary
chown 150 file 将文件 file UID改为150
23    chgrp
[语法]: chgrp [-R] 文件组 文件...
[说明] 文件的GID表示文件的文件组,文件组可用数字表示, 也可用一个有效的组名表示,此命令改变一个文件的GID,可参看chown
-R 递归地改变所有子目录下所有文件的存取模式
chgrp group file 将文件 file 的文件组改为 group
24    mount
[语法]: mount [-r] 设备 目录
[说明]: 将设备安装到目录下
-r 以只读方式安装
25    umount
[语法]: umount 设备